Name |
Last commit
|
Last update |
---|---|---|
.. | ||
branches | ||
reflog | ||
crashes.c | ||
create.c | ||
delete.c | ||
foreachglob.c | ||
isvalidname.c | ||
list.c | ||
listall.c | ||
lookup.c | ||
normalize.c | ||
overwrite.c | ||
pack.c | ||
peel.c | ||
read.c | ||
rename.c | ||
revparse.c | ||
unicode.c | ||
update.c |
It's somewhat common to try to write "/refs/tags/something". There is no easy way to catch it during the main body of the function, as there is no way to distinguish whether it's a leading slash or a double slash somewhere in the middle. Catch this at the beginning so we don't trigger the assert in is_all_caps_and_underscore().
Name |
Last commit
|
Last update |
---|---|---|
.. | ||
branches | Loading commit data... | |
reflog | Loading commit data... | |
crashes.c | Loading commit data... | |
create.c | Loading commit data... | |
delete.c | Loading commit data... | |
foreachglob.c | Loading commit data... | |
isvalidname.c | Loading commit data... | |
list.c | Loading commit data... | |
listall.c | Loading commit data... | |
lookup.c | Loading commit data... | |
normalize.c | Loading commit data... | |
overwrite.c | Loading commit data... | |
pack.c | Loading commit data... | |
peel.c | Loading commit data... | |
read.c | Loading commit data... | |
rename.c | Loading commit data... | |
revparse.c | Loading commit data... | |
unicode.c | Loading commit data... | |
update.c | Loading commit data... |